# Android 动画中的 Alpha 属性
在 Android 开发中,动画是提升用户体验的重要组成部分。而在众多动画效果中,Alpha 动画是一种相对简单却极具表现力的方式,用于控制视图的透明度。在这篇文章中,我们将深入探讨 Android 中的 Alpha 动画,包括如何实现它的基本代码示例,以及简单的状态图和序列图来帮助我们理解。
## Alpha 属性概述
Alpha 属性定义了
# Android 动画 alpha 实现
## 1. 概述
在 Android 开发中,动画是提升用户体验的重要组成部分。其中,alpha 动画可以实现控件的透明度渐变效果,使界面更加生动和有吸引力。本文将介绍如何在 Android 中实现 alpha 动画。
## 2. 实现步骤
下表展示了实现 alpha 动画的步骤: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创
原创
2024-01-02 04:29:34
94阅读
# Android Alpha 动画实现
## 引言
在Android开发中,动画是一种非常重要的交互方式,能够为用户提供更好的体验。Alpha动画是其中一种常用的动画效果,可以通过改变控件的透明度来实现渐变的效果。本文将教你如何实现Android Alpha动画。
## 步骤概览
下面是实现Android Alpha动画的步骤概览:
| 步骤 | 描述 |
| --- | --- |
|
原创
2023-07-21 21:43:05
309阅读
效果图:Android动画有3类: 1.View Animation (Tween Animation) 2.Drawable Animation (Frame Animation) 2.Property Animation其中,上述效果是用第二类属性动画做的。什么是属性动画? 通俗的说,属性动画就是在一定的时间内,按照一定的规律来改变对象的属性(该属性对于该对象应该是从形态(大小,位置
转载
2024-07-23 09:42:36
9阅读
# Android Alpha 属性动画
在 Android 开发中,动画是提升用户体验的重要元素之一。属性动画(Property Animation)提供了一种灵活且强大的方式来处理各种动画效果。本文将重点介绍 Alpha 属性动画,这是一种控制视图透明度的简单方式。我们将通过代码示例来演示如何实现和使用 Alpha 动画,并用一些可视化工具来辅助理解。
## 什么是 Alpha 动画?
# Android 中 Alpha 属性动画的实现
在 Android 开发中,属性动画是实现视图动态效果的重要手段之一。Alpha 属性动画可以实现视图的透明度变化,从而产生淡入淡出等效果。本文将详细介绍如何在 Android 中实现 Alpha 属性动画,适合刚入门的开发者学习。
## 流程概述
我们将通过以下步骤实现 Alpha 属性动画:
| 步骤 | 描述
# 在Android中实现属性动画alpha效果的完整指南
属性动画是一种强大且灵活的方式,可以让我们在Android应用中实现视图的数值变化,包括透明度(alpha)的变化。下面,我们将详细讲解如何在Android中实现alpha属性动画,并展示具体的代码示例和解释。
## 整体流程
为了清晰地了解整个实现过程,我们将整个流程分为以下几个步骤:
| 步骤 | 描述 |
|------|-
## 实现 Android Alpha 动画
### 介绍
在 Android 开发中,Alpha 动画常用于实现透明度的渐变效果。本文将教授如何使用代码实现 Android Alpha 动画。
### 流程
下表展示了实现 Android Alpha 动画的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建 Alpha 动画对象 |
| 2 | 设置动画的起始
原创
2023-12-04 11:24:15
45阅读
窗口动画 alpha 是 Android 开发中常见的一种界面动画效果,通过不同的 alpha 值实现 UI 界面的视觉吸引力和流畅度。为了深入研究“窗口动画 alpha android”的实现,我们将从以下几个方面进行复盘记录:协议背景、抓包方法、报文结构、交互过程、多协议对比和逆向案例。
## 协议背景
在 Android 的窗口动画中,alpha 通常代表透明度属性,取值范围在 0 到
前几篇文章我们介绍了ObjectAnimator和ValueAnimator的基本用法。TypeEvaluator(估值器)细心的朋友会发现我们有一个东西没有用到。public static ValueAnimator ofObject(TypeEvaluator evaluator, Object... values)当我们ValueAnimator.ofObject()函数来做动画效果的时候就
转载
2023-12-25 21:47:20
55阅读
## 实现Android的alpha属性动画
### 流程步骤
下面是实现Android的alpha属性动画的步骤表格: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建一个AlphaAnimation对象 |
| 2 | 设置动画的起始透明度和结束透明度 |
| 3 | 设置动画的持续时间 |
| 4 | 设置动画的重复模式 |
| 5 | 将动画应用到View上 |
原创
2024-04-09 04:03:04
171阅读
一:ValueAnimator类 1.ValueAnimator是属性动画中一个比较重要的类。我们知道属性动画和补间动画不同的是,补间动画并不是直接对View进行操作,而是在进行位移,旋转等等动画后绘制的结果。我们点击动画后的View发现并不能触发点击事件,而属性动画则是完全对View的操作。ValueAnimator用于处理初始值到结束值之间过渡,它的内部使用时间处理机制来让动画平滑的过渡。平
转载
2024-09-12 23:06:17
89阅读
# Android Activity 进场动画 Alpha 实现指南
作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白们学习如何实现 Android Activity 的进场动画。在这篇文章中,我将详细介绍实现 Alpha 动画的整个流程,并提供代码示例和注释,以帮助您更好地理解每一步。
## 流程图
首先,让我们通过一个流程图来了解实现 Android Activity 进场动画 Al
原创
2024-07-30 08:23:11
92阅读
(一)使用动画的时候:1、OOM问题 当使用帧动画的时候,需要考虑到这个问题。当图片数量较多、较大的时候,就很可能会出现OOM。所以还是尽量避免使用帧动画。2、内存泄漏 在使用属性动画的时候,有一类无限循环的动画,这类动画建议在Activity销毁的时候及时停止动画,否则会导致activity无法释放,从而导致内存泄漏。3、硬件加速器
转载
2023-06-26 13:16:31
180阅读
DVM指dalivk的虚拟机。每一个Android应用程序都在它自己的进程中运行,都拥有一个独立的Dalvik虚拟机实例。而每一个DVM都是在Linux中的一个进程,所以说可以认为是同一个概念。 1、sim卡的EF文件有何作用。sim卡的文件系统有自己规范,主要是为了和手机通讯,sim本身可以有自己的操作系统,EF就是作存储并和手机通讯用的。嵌入式操作系统内存管理有哪几种, 各有何特性页
转载
2024-10-12 13:10:36
8阅读
1、工具类enum class AnimationState {
STATE_SHOW, //显示
STATE_HIDE, //隐藏
STATE_SHOW_UP,
STATE_HIDE_UP,
STATE_SHOW_DOWN,
STATE_HIDE_DOWN,
STATE_SHOW_LEFT,
STATE_HIDE_LEFT,
转载
2023-06-28 17:15:49
126阅读
Android 平台提供了两类动画。 一类是Tween动画,就是对场景里的对象不断的进行图像变化来产生动画效果(旋转、平移、放缩和渐变)。 下面就讲一下Tweene Animations。 主要类: Animation 动画 AlphaAnimation 渐变透明度 RotateAnimation 画面旋转 ScaleAnimation 渐变尺寸缩放 TranslateAnimation 位置移
转载
2024-03-03 09:36:33
122阅读
XML 的定义方式 <alpha xmlns:android="http://schemas.android.com/apk/res/android" android:detachWallpaper="true" android:duration="1000" android:fillEnabled="true" androi
原创
2021-06-01 15:46:38
1375阅读
文章目录1、现象2、文件结构3、alpha.xml 定义动画4、activity_main.xml 布局文件5、MainActivity.java 功能文件1、现象2、文件结构3、alpha.xml 定义动画<?xml version="1.0" encoding="utf-8"?><set xmlns:android="http://schemas.an...
原创
2023-11-22 11:49:56
112阅读
动画类型Android的animation由四种类型组成XML中alpha渐变透明度动画效果scale渐变尺寸伸缩动画效果translate画面转换位置移动动画效果rotate画面转移旋转动画效果JavaCode中AlphaAnimation渐变透明度动画效果ScaleAnimation渐变尺寸伸缩...
转载
2021-08-11 10:25:31
856阅读